Job Description:
Job Summary: In addition to providing Sonographer duties in a
hospital and/or clinic setting; provision of supervision of
Sonographer Students in the clinical setting; perform all duties in
a manner which promotes team concepts and reflects the KPNW mission
and philosophy.Essential Responsibilities:
- Performing diagnostic procedures, using knowledge, skills and
abilities required for age of patient served to include: Routine,
emergent, portable, surgical examinations in accordance with
department policies and procedures.
- Communication with Radiologist and Student.
- Assist patient/transport.
- Restocking supplies/cleaning. Quality Assurance functions.
Other duties as assigned.
- Variable: Participates in on-call or standby schedule as
required. Basic Qualifications: Experience
- Minimum three (3) years of work experience in modality.
Experience must be no more than three (3) years from the date of
application. Education
- Graduate of an CAAHEP Accredited Ultrasonographer Program at
time of hire or two (2) years previous Ultrasound experience.
- High School Diploma or General Education Development (GED)
required. License, Certification, Registration
- Sonography Technologist License (Oregon)
- Registered Diagnostic Medical Sonographer Certificate - Abdomen
from American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onographers
- Basic Life Support within 1 months of hire
- Registered Diagnostic Medical Sonographer Certificate - Ob-Gyn
from American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onographers
